Output 35ca1050323229c1398cb34604bcb601e312133c1a8a6a63190ab4e7b7aa91f0:3

value
84942491
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 018aeca06a8dbc58ae72cdd01ea1909448bd7f49 OP_EQUALVERIFY OP_CHECKSIG
address
19A6pjZhxCt8orhvzy6B2Fd73x1HA9ee5
transaction
35ca1050323229c1398cb34604bcb601e312133c1a8a6a63190ab4e7b7aa91f0
confirmations
508500
spent
true